Memo — Training Budget, Next Year. Heads of department: the central training budget at Vellorn Partners is held flat. Submit prioritised requests by month-end; anything unranked will be deferred. Mandatory compliance courses are funded separately and are not optional. Discretionary travel for external courses needs sign-off. Rationale for the allocation is set out in the confidential note below.

management briefing: Project Ulavan slips by two quarters because of the staffing delay.

Changelog — RateWarden v4.2 (Hollis Travel Tech). Changed defaults for the rate-parity checker. Scan interval drops from hourly to every 15 minutes. Tolerance threshold tightened from 2% to 0.5% before a parity breach is flagged. Stale quotes older than 30 minutes are now discarded instead of averaged. Channel weighting removed; all sources count equally. Rollout hits all tenants Thursday; no action needed unless you override defaults. New installations ship with the following default configuration.

config for bahaf-yagef:
[prair]
team = zordor
access_code = ac_f81712
host = prair.olvarqcloud.local
port = 3306
owner = quenix.fraiel
peer = istys.torvaworks.internal

## Local Setup — Bloom Filter Frontend

Heads up: the Wrenhollow cache puts a bloom filter in front of the key-value store, so "not found" responses are usually instant. To run it locally, start the store first, then launch the filter service so it can warm up from recorded keys. The warm-up reads from the metadata database — connect to it with the string below.

primary connection of tajeg-tajop = postgresql://julax_svc:DI@db-e7f3.kelvidyn.corp:5432/rusdor